Technical Specifications

Side-by-side comparison of Radeon RX 5600 and Radeon Pro 5700

AMD

Radeon RX 5600

The Radeon RX 5600 is manufactured by AMD. It was released in July 7 2020. It features the RDNA 1.0 architecture. The core clock ranges from 1035 MHz to 1265 MHz. It has 2304 shading units. The thermal design power (TDP) is 150W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 11,753 points.

AMD

Radeon Pro 5700

The Radeon Pro 5700 is manufactured by AMD. It was released in August 4 2020. It features the RDNA 1.0 architecture. The core clock ranges from 1243 MHz to 1350 MHz. It has 2304 shading units. The thermal design power (TDP) is 130W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 11,469 points.

Graphics Performance

The Radeon RX 5600 scores 11,753 and the Radeon Pro 5700 reaches 11,469 in the G3D Mark benchmark — just a 2.5% difference, making them near-identical in rasterization performance. The Radeon RX 5600 is built on RDNA 1.0 while the Radeon Pro 5700 uses RDNA 1.0, both on a 7 nm process. Shader units: 2,304 (Radeon RX 5600) vs 2,304 (Radeon Pro 5700). Raw compute: 5.829 TFLOPS (Radeon RX 5600) vs 6.221 TFLOPS (Radeon Pro 5700). Boost clocks: 1265 MHz vs 1350 MHz.

Video Memory (VRAM)

The Radeon RX 5600 comes with 6 GB of VRAM, while the Radeon Pro 5700 has 8 GB. The Radeon Pro 5700 offers 33.3%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 192-bit vs 128-bit. L2 Cache: 3 MB (Radeon RX 5600) vs 4 MB (Radeon Pro 5700) — the Radeon Pro 5700 has significantly larger on-die cache to reduce VRAM reliance.

Power & Dimensions

The Radeon RX 5600 draws 150W versus the Radeon Pro 5700's 130W — a 14.3% difference. The Radeon Pro 5700 is more power-efficient. Recommended PSU: 500W (Radeon RX 5600) vs 500W (Radeon Pro 5700). Power connectors: PCIe-powered vs PCIe-powered. Card length: 241mm vs 267mm, occupying 2 vs 2 slots. Typical load temperature: 80°C vs 80°C.
